VP5k Saturday 18th May 2024

By Phil Coakes on May 21, 2024

VP5k Races 2024 Saturday 18th May

Report by John Stinson

The Caversham Harrier Club held their Annual Vice President’s 5K Races in cold wet conditions at Bayfield Park last Saturday with the course circuiting the Park and Streets surrounding the Anderson’s Bay Inlet. The race was formerly held around Forbury Park Raceway for 97 Years with the first recorded edition being 1925. Despite the inclement conditions competitors still managed to convey an atmosphere of enthusiasm and enjoyment to everyone involved. Their appreciation shown to the Marshal’s around the Course and to the Recorder’s and Timekeepers at the Start/Finish area was great. The Winner of the Senior 5K race was Kerry Rowley with Leon Miyahara recording Fastest Time honours. Rhondda Rowley was first finisher in the 5K Walk with New Zealand Race Walking representative Alex Brown recording Fastest time of 26.40. In the Colts race Nate Crawford was first to finish with Fastest time recorded by Josh Keogh with 3.47

Results: Vice President’s 5 K Run 1st Kerry Rowley,2nd Sharon Bungard 3rd Nicholas Heng. Fastest times Leon Miyahara 16.49 Jono Ryan 18.16 Simon Walker 20.18.

Walkers 5K 1st Rhondda Rowley,2nd Shona McDonald 3rd Fiona Turnbull. Fastest times Alex Brown 26.40 Katherine Van Der Vliet 36.59 Lara Findlater 37.28

Colts 1st Nate Crawford 2nd Calum Starkey 3rd Quinn Reynolds Fastest times Josh Keogh 3.47 Nate Crawford 4.15 Perry Saker 4.22

     

Two cheerful competitors starting off together were Wendy Crawford and Anne Watkins who would like it recorded they both competed valiantly and finished together
